- WIDEMAN, Connie (nee Soehner) - Wideman_Connie Passed away on Thursday, March 5, 2015 at Grand River Hospital. Connie at the age of 82 years was of Kitchener, formerly of Elmira.
Dear mother of Joel (Darlene), Deric (Fiona), Mary-Esther Chowan (Don), Tina Hanley (Mike), and mother-in-law of Val Wideman. Also lovingly remembered by her ten grandchildren Benjamin, Samantha; Jennifer, Heather and Nathan; Stefanie and Ashley; Kyle, Matthew and Jeremy; and by her two great-grandchildren Evva and Cadence. Sister of Joyce Strebel, Janice and Merle Manto. Predeceased by her son Andrew (2007), her parents Henry and Bertha (Hoelscher) Soehner, brothers Wallace, Harry and Lorne (in infancy) and sister Pauline Walser.
At Connie's request cremation has taken place. There will be no funeral home visitation or funeral service. A family graveside service will be held in the spring. Arrangements out of Elmira.
